Abstract
Despite increasing take-up, the growth of email has been slower than predicted, casting doubts on its significance in the workplace. The purpose of this paper is to assess the future role of email, taking account of both the benefits and the problems experienced in the past, and of organisational changes predicted for the 1990s. It focuses on the organisational impact of the medium, as revealed in numerous studied of its use, and the implications of this for the future
